HTTP client — maxim/utils/http.py (Plan 1 R1)

The single place outbound HTTP happens in src/maxim/. Adding new HTTP calls outside this module is blocked by a CI grep invariant:

grep -r "urllib.request.urlopen" src/maxim/ | grep -v "utils/http.py"
# Expected: empty

Three public surfaces — pick the one that fits your call site:

Function When to use Endpoint
http.get(name, path, **kw) / http.post(name, path, **kw) Calling a registered endpoint by name (leader admin calls after R1 lands them, Plan 3's _MaximPeerBackend) Registry-based
http.fetch_url(url, method="GET", **kw) Calling an arbitrary URL where the target isn't known at registration time (tool fetches, HF model downloads, peer CLI remote admin) _external (lazily registered, internal=False)
http.download_to_file(url, dest_path, progress_hook=..., **kw) Streaming a large file to disk with progress callbacks (GGUF downloads) _external
http.raw_proxy_forward(url, method, headers, body, timeout) Reserved for leader_proxy._proxy_request only. Bypasses sanitization + X-Maxim-* injection to forward client headers verbatim. Do not use elsewhere. _external (raw)

Two registered endpoints in R1:

  • "leader" — registered by peer/config.apply_peer_config_to_env. internal=True, late-bound auth via MAXIM_LANE_LARGE_REMOTE_API_KEY, 3/60/120 timeout policy.
  • "_external" — registered lazily by _ensure_external_endpoint(). internal=False (no X-Maxim-* leak to third parties), User-Agent set once, 5/120/600 long-timeout policy.

Typed HTTP errors: HTTPTimeout, HTTPConnectionError, HTTPAuthError, HTTPServerError, HTTPClientError, HTTPRateLimited — all inherit from HTTPError and carry .status + .fix_hint. Callers branch on these instead of string-matching exception messages.

Env vars:

  • MAXIM_HTTP_TRACE=1 — bumps http_request events from DEBUG to INFO
  • MAXIM_LOG_FILE=/path/to/x.jsonl — attaches a JSONL file handler via StructuredFormatter

Removed in R0 (2026-04-11)

R0 of the LLM Path Refinement plan deleted ~1,250 LOC of dead mesh scaffolding from src/maxim/mesh/. These modules had zero production imports — they were swept along during the task→size lane refactor and never re-wired. Historical note: docs/troubleshooting/mesh.md.

Deleted What it was Replacement
mesh/peer_registry.py Speculative peer registry Plan 4's mesh.yml + admin API (not yet shipped)
mesh/peer_info.py Peer metadata (trust level, capabilities) Plan 4 node entries in mesh.yml
mesh/peer_channel.py Bi-directional peer message channel None — direct HTTP via utils/http.py
mesh/task_delegation.py Cross-peer goal delegation None — out of scope for current cluster
mesh/knowledge.py ExperienceBroker for shared CausalLinks Deferred; see substrate plan cross-agent transfer
mesh/clock.py PeerClockEstimator (NTP-free) Operators use real NTP
mesh/agent_identity.py Tool-list advertisement Plan 4 admin API
mesh/admission.py Rate limiter — cherry-picked to runtime/rate_limit.py Lives in runtime/rate_limit.py now

Still present in src/maxim/mesh/: bus.py, identity.py, message.py, naming.py — simulation-only consumers in simulation/ and create.py.


Bio-System Glossary

Maxim uses neuroscience-inspired names. Here is the translation:

Bio Name Plain English Module What It Does
Hippocampus Episodic memory memory/ Stores and recalls experiences (events, conversations)
ATL Semantic memory memory/ Extracts concepts, categories, and generalizations
NAc Reward / causal learning decisions/ Learns cause-and-effect relationships ("what leads to what"). distribute_reward now wired via ReactionBus subscriber in build_bio_stack
SCN Internal clock time/ Tracks circadian-like temporal patterns and rhythms. Kuramoto oscillator learns event-type co-occurrence for anticipatory temporal credit (B2)
EC Memory indexing + substrate recognition similarity/ Routes queries via similarity; pattern_complete_or_separate for substrate nodes (P1)
Angular Gyrus Cross-modal algebra math/ Combines memories across different modalities
Cerebellum Motor prediction embodiment/ Predicts outcomes of physical actions, learns motor programs. Now activated in production via BioStack.cerebellum and build_executor(cerebellum=...)
Amygdala / Fear Threat detection proprioception/ Detects harm, triggers pain signals, gates risky actions
Default Network Reactive behavior default_network/ Background processing, idle behaviors, spontaneous thoughts
Valence Affective edge signal memory/episode.py Affective signal on Hebbian edges (Edge.metadata["valence"]), computed from Reactions at episode close via apply_hebbian_on_close. Propagated by spreading_activation(propagate_valence=True)
Episode Boundary Rules Pluggable boundary detection memory/episode.py BoundaryRule callables on EpisodeBoundaryDetector. Defaults: tick gap, channel change, scn_tag change. New: salience_spike_rule(min_intensity=0.5) triggers boundary on pain/salience spikes via CaptureEvent.salience_spike

Operating Modes

Maxim's mode system combines two dimensions:

  1. ProcessingState -- awake or sleep. Determines whether the agent loop is running.
  2. OperationalMode -- planning, supervised, or autonomous. Controls permissions and initiative level.

Sleep is not a mode -- it is a processing state the agent enters by calling the sleep tool and exits automatically when user input arrives.

Planning System

Component Location Description
PlanManager planning/plan_manager.py Plan lifecycle management
DecisionEngine planning/decision_engine.py Single point of action selection
Policy planning/policy.py Constraints and guardrails
PlanDocument planning/plan_document.py Structured plan representation

Decision flow:

Observe state -> Agents propose intents -> Planners propose plans
    -> Policies constrain plans -> Decision engine selects action
    -> Runtime executes

Feature Reference

Feature Description
Adaptive Planning ADaPT + Reflexion hybrid: direct execution first, recursive decomposition on failure
Multi-Signal Scoring Plans scored across 6 dimensions: NAc value, EC familiarity, concept relevance, delay efficiency, depth penalty, action cost
Parallel Execution Independent sub-goals run concurrently with thread pools
Reflection Loops Surprising failures (RPE > 0.3) generate verbal self-critiques stored as episodic memories
Prompt Profiles minimal, standard, rich profiles for different hardware
Checkpointing Persist and resume goal trees across restarts
FearAgent Safety review for sensitive operations before execution
Pain Detection Proprioceptive monitoring for aversive movement patterns
Harm Prediction Zero-latency prediction of harmful outcomes before execution
Contemplation Local chain-of-thought: multi-pass critique+refine for complex plans
Energy Tracking Resource expenditure monitoring for tokens, compute, and movement
Introspection Tools 10 read-only tools exposing biological subsystems to the LLM
Learned Tool Index Keyword-weighted hashtable learns which tools match which goals; saves ~74% of tool-context tokens
Coding Tools Edit files, search code, run tests, git diff/commit with structured error reporting
Skills & Protocols Composable capabilities with lifecycle states and workspace constraints
SMS/Voice Comms Send and receive texts/calls via Twilio
Generative Campaigns LLM-driven narrative arcs, bridge-and-compress for long campaigns
Research Protocol Multi-agent research: Researcher + Writer + Reviewer agents, dual-LLM, experiment tracking
Embodiment SEM protocol (Sensor-Entity-Modulator) for body definition, Cerebellum forward models, motor programs with engrams, ComponentIndex semantic discovery
Imagination Real-time entity design from novel percept mentions: entity extraction → ComponentIndex lookup → LLM design → ephemeral registration. DN arousal-gated, energy-budgeted. Imagined entities carry provenance tags on Episodes and CausalLinks
Agent Mesh Cooperative peer-to-peer network: knowledge sharing, task delegation, distributed planning, SCN clock sync
Multi-LLM Scaling Local + remote + cloud LLM backends, Cloudflare tunnel, per-tier model routing, hot-swap
Benchmarks Multi-model comparative testing with bio-system expectations and scenario suites
